Physical Education Associate in Arts Degree

PROGRAM CODE: 2A17369

The Physical Education Associate in Arts Degree is designed for students who will transfer to a four-year institution, obtaining a bachelor’s degree through a California State University program. Course and degree requirements vary at respective universities. It is important to consult with a Fullerton College Counselor and respective university transfer representatives to confer program requirements and transferable work. The Program requires a total of 18-20 units of which 16-17 units are in required courses. An additional 2-3 units must be chosen from the restricted units listed below.

American Red Cross certification can be substituted at the discretion of the Division. Students must take an additional 3 units from restricted electives.

Outcome 1: Examine personal health-related behavioral patterns, select goals and formulate appropriate health and fitness strategies

Outcome 2: Demonstrate an understanding of anatomy, nutrition, health promotion as well as behavior development as it applies to Kinesiology and Physical Education.
